What is a Valve Assembly?

A valve assembly is essentially the heart of many systems, controlling the flow of liquids or gases. Think of it as the gatekeeper; it opens and closes pathways to ensure everything runs smoothly. Commonly found in plumbing, automotive engines, and industrial applications, it's a vital component you can't overlook.

Common Issues with Valve Assemblies

Like any other mechanical component, valve assemblies can experience their fair share of issues. Here are a few common problems:

  • Leaks: One of the most common headaches is leakage. This can stem from wear and tear or improper installation. A tiny drip might seem harmless, but it can lead to big problems!
  • Blockages: Sometimes, debris can clog your valve assembly, causing it to malfunction. A good cleaning can often fix this issue, but regular maintenance is key!
  • Wear and Tear: Over time, components can wear down. If you notice any unusual noises or performance issues, it's time for a check-up.

How to Maintain Your Valve Assembly

Now that we've covered the basics and common issues, let's talk maintenance. Here are a few tips to keep your valve assembly running smoothly:

  • Regular Inspections: Make it a habit to inspect your valve assembly regularly. Look for signs of wear, rust, or leaks.
  • Cleanliness is Key: Keep the area around your valve assembly clean. This can help prevent blockages and ensure proper function.
  • Follow Manufacturer Guidelines: Always refer to the manufacturer's instructions for specific maintenance requirements. They know their product best!

When to Replace Your Valve Assembly

There comes a time when repair just won't cut it. Here are a few indicators that it might be time to consider a replacement:

  • If your valve assembly is over ten years old and showing signs of failure.
  • After multiple repairs, if issues persist, it may be more cost-effective to replace.
  • Any significant performance drop can indicate that it's time for a new assembly.
